Mahabharata Shanti Parva – यदीच्छसि शरियं तात यादृशीं तां युधिष्ठिरे

Shloka (श्लोक)

यदीच्छसि शरियं तात यादृशीं तां युधिष्ठिरे
विशिष्टां वा नरव्याघ्र शीलवान भव पुत्रक

⚡ Quick Meaning

This shloka advises Yudhishthira on the qualities of character that define true nobility.

Translations

English Translation

If you desire strength and greatness, O son, then aspire to possess character and quality like that of noble beings or a hero, for they embody true virtue.

हिंदी अनुवाद

यदि आप शक्ति और महानता की इच्छा रखते हैं, पुत्र, तो उन गुणों और विशेषताओं की ओर अग्रसर हों जो उत्कृष्ट व्यक्तियों या वीरों में होती हैं, क्योंकि यही सच्चा धर्म है।

Commentary

Context

This shloka presents a guideline for Yudhishthira, emphasizing the value of character in achieving noble goals in the Shanti Parva.

Meaning

The essence lies in emphasizing that true strength is rooted in virtue and good character, rather than mere physical prowess.

Application

This verse encourages us to strive for character and integrity in our pursuits, recognizing that these are the traits that lead to true greatness.
